Mobile Robots: Navigation, Control and Remote Sensing
Gerald Cook, George Mason University
John Wiley & Sons, Inc., 2011
ISBN: 978-0-470-63021-1;
Language: English
Written for a one-semester course in electrical engineering, this book provides comprehensive coverage of mobile robot applications. The book presents the major areas of mobile robot applications—control, navigation, and remote sensing—which are essential to not only detecting desired objects but also providing accurate information on their precise locations. Topics include kinematic models for mobile robots, mobile robot control, robot attitude, and robot navigation.
MATLAB is used to solve example problems in the book.
